Types of News Media Sites
News media sites have evolved over the years to cater to diverse tastes and preferences of readers. The types of news media sites can be broadly classified into several categories, each with its unique features and focus areas.
General News Sites
These sites provide a comprehensive coverage of news from around the world, including politics, business, entertainment, and more. They often have a team of journalists and editors who work tirelessly to bring the latest news to their readers. Examples of general news sites include The New York Times, The Guardian, and Al Jazeera.
Sports News Sites
Sports enthusiasts have a dedicated space to stay updated on the latest news, scores, and live matches. These sites often have a strong focus on specific sports, such as football, cricket, or basketball, and provide in-depth analysis, scores, and highlights. Examples of sports news sites include ESPN, Sky Sports, and Sports Illustrated.
Specialized News Sites
These sites focus on specific topics or industries, such as technology, healthcare, or finance. They provide in-depth coverage and analysis of the latest developments in their respective fields. Examples of specialized news sites include The Verge (technology), The Lancet (healthcare), and The Financial Times (finance).
Blog-Style News Sites
These sites often have a more personal touch, with individual bloggers or writers sharing their perspectives and insights on various topics. They may not have the same level of resources or infrastructure as larger news organizations, but they can provide a unique and engaging perspective on the news. Examples of blog-style news sites include The Huffington Post and The Daily Beast.
Live News Sites
These sites provide real-time updates on breaking news, often with a focus on fast-paced and developing stories. They may have a strong focus on live coverage, such as live blogs, live tweets, or live video streaming. Examples of live news sites include BBC News and CNN.

Best Practices for News Media Sites
When it comes to news media sites, it’s crucial to prioritize accuracy, speed, and user experience. Here are some best practices to help you achieve this:
Stay Up-to-Date with the Latest News
News is a fast-paced and ever-changing industry. To stay ahead of the curve, it’s essential to have a system in place for aggregating and publishing the latest news. This can include using news wires, setting up RSS feeds, and having a team of journalists and editors working around the clock to bring readers the most up-to-date information.
Provide Live Coverage of Major Events
For major events, such as live matches or breaking news stories, it’s crucial to provide real-time coverage. This can include live blogs, live tweets, and live video streaming. By doing so, you can keep readers engaged and informed as the story unfolds.
Offer a Global Perspective with World News
News is a global phenomenon, and it’s essential to reflect this in your coverage. By providing a global perspective on world news, you can attract a diverse range of readers and offer a unique perspective on international events.
Use Clear and Concise Headlines
Headlines are crucial in grabbing readers’ attention and conveying the essence of a story. To do this effectively, use clear and concise language that accurately reflects the content of the article. Avoid using sensational or misleading headlines that may attract the wrong kind of attention.
Make it Easy for Readers to Find What They’re Looking For
A well-organized website is essential for making it easy for readers to find what they’re looking for. Use clear and descriptive categories, tags, and keywords to help readers navigate your site and find relevant content.
Use Social Media to Promote Your Content
Social media is a powerful tool for promoting your content and reaching a wider audience. Use platforms like Twitter, Facebook, and LinkedIn to share your latest news and articles, and engage with readers by responding to comments and messages.
